WHAT DOES ANAESTHETIC M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Anesthetic

An anesthetic (American) (or anaesthetic, (British English) see spelling differences) is a drug that causes anesthesia—reversible loss of sensation. Anesthetics contrast with analgesics (painkillers), which relieve pain without eliminating sensation. These drugs are generally administered to facilitate surgery. A wide variety of drugs are used in modern anesthetic practice. Many are rarely used outside of anesthesia, although others are used commonly by all disciplines. Anesthetics are categorized into two classes: general anesthetics, which cause a reversible loss of consciousness, and local anesthetics, which cause a reversible loss of sensation for a limited region of the body while maintaining consciousness. Combinations of anesthetics are sometimes used for their synergistic and additive therapeutic effects. Adverse effects, however, may also be increased.

Definition of anaesthetic in the English dictionary

The definition of anaesthetic in the dictionary is a substance that causes anaesthesia. Other definition of anaesthetic is causing or characterized by anaesthesia.
